title image


Smiley objCommand.ExecuteNonQuery löst Serverfehler aus
aus einer CodeBehind:



Dim conn As String = "Provider=Microsoft.Jet.OLEDB.4.0; Data Source=C:\Inetpub\wwwroot\test.mdb"

sql1 = " UPDATE .... WHERE ...;"

Dim objConn As New OleDbConnection(conn)

Dim objCommand As New OleDbCommand(sql1, objConn)

objConn.Open()

erg = objCommand.ExecuteNonQuery()





Die letzte Zeile löst einen Serverfehler aus:

Für mindestens einen erforderlichen Parameter wurde kein Wert angegeben.

Ausnahmedetails: System.Data.OleDb.OleDbException: Für mindestens einen erforderlichen Parameter wurde kein Wert angegeben.

lt. Hilfe hat die Function ExecuteNonQuery aber gar keine Argumente und wenn ich Textfelder aus meiner test.mdb füllen will, klappt folgendes hingegen problemlos:





objReader = objCommand.ExecuteReader()

objReader.Read()



was mache ich falsch?



My Konfig: WIN XP SP2; .NET Framework Version:1.0.3705.209; ASP.NET-Version:1.0.3705.0



Gruss

Ernst
Gruss Ernst ---------------------------------------------------------------------------------- WIN XP prof, Office XP, Visual Studio (.net) 2002 + 2005

geschrieben von

Login

E-Mail:
  

Passwort:
  

Beitrag anfügen

Symbol:
 
 
 
 
 
 
 
 
 
 
 
 
 

Überschrift: